ABSTRACT:
Device for the detection of liquid surfaces including a light source sending light onto a liquid surface, an oscillation element which is moved toward the liquid surface and causes the liquid surface to oscillate upon contact with the surface. The surface contact is detected by a light detector which picks up the radiation reflected by the liquid. Upon contact with the liquid, the light sent out by the light source is modulated by the oscillations of the liquid surface. The so modulated signal can be selectively identified by the detector.
